Welcome to Pack Your Passport Baby!

My name is Allyson and I live in Toronto, Canada.  Pre-baby, my husband Mark and I were avid travelers and frequently traveled in the Americas, Europe, Africa - and Asia, our favourite destination.  When our son was born, we were more than a little concerned that our travels would be completely curtailed, however with each passing trip our confidence has grown. 

Our son is now two years old, and we have enjoyed many wonderful travels with him in North America and Europe, and we're chomping at the bit to take him to Asia.  I am a planner at heart and throughout these travels, I thoroughly researched our destinations looking for any advice I could find about traveling with a baby.  Most online advice relates to families with older children so finding specific advice relating to babies and younger children was a bit of a challenge.
Traveling with our son hasn't always been easy, but it has been very rewarding.  I often think about playgrounds our son enjoyed while in Maui, and the gorgeous views Mark and I were treated to at the same time.   I believe most important part about traveling with a child is visiting places the whole family will enjoy, rather than restricting your travels to only child-based destinations.

In this blog I hope to share tips and tricks I've learned along the way, things like keeping a toddler busy on an airplane, choosing an airplane seat and figuring out what to pack.  If you have any comments or suggestions for readers on great child-friendly venues, travel destinations or your own travel tip, please share them by emailing me at packyourpassport@gmail.ca.
